Orbital elements:
2005 XE1
Epoch 2005 Nov. 26.0 TT = JDT 2453700.5                 MPC
M  32.20777              (2000.0)            P               Q
n   0.52272532     Peri.  322.04675     +0.61404576     -0.61404221
a   1.5262313      Node    83.88434     +0.78923124     +0.47143569
e   0.1818645      Incl.   29.91544     +0.00786441     +0.63300912
P   1.89           H   18.9           G   0.15
From 17 observations 2005 Dec. 4-5.
